Agreed, but anything over 120hz is kind of overkill (ya can't really see a visible difference between 120hz, 144hz, 240hz, etc. in 60fps (which is what most sports are shot/shown in).

hz = hertz (the way refresh rate is measured in monitors/tvs)
fps = frames per second, basically for every second 60 frames/pictures are in it. Most movies are 24 fps, most TV/YouTube is 30 fps and then sports are captured in 60 fps and it's mainly so when they slow it down they don't lose frames.

There are a LOT of cheap tvs with 60hz refresh rate though (or fake 120), and you should definitely avoid those.
 
Great post. Another thing to understand since people usually don’t think about it is your Wi-Fi speed (you kinda hit this point). True 4K streaming takes up ~25-30 Mbps for data speed. If this is your plans top speed I can promise you that you aren’t getting your 4K streaming because there are most definitely other objects on the network taking up bandwidth (like little Jimmy surfing the web). To test your bandwidth speed just go to fast.com and run the test. Another thing to consider is your Wi-Fi range. Hardwired is always best, but Wi-Fi is very convenient so if you are having dropping issues it could be due to the Wi-Fi card in your device not being able to pick up the Wi-Fi signal being broadcasted by your AP.

Also, PLEASE buy a top of the line HDMI cord. Amazon basics (and other equivalents) is not top of the line nor is it going to give you that “4K” picture it says it will. Remember, there is a reason it is $4.99. And to be honest the HDMI cords that usually come with the device you buy is usually not good either. Top of the line HDMI cords will be made with better internals/metals to allow crisp clear audio and video to travel through the line consistently and will not degrade nowhere near as quick as these cheap ones.

Small piggy back, with HDMI cords ya gotta look at what type of HDMI it is too. You need a 2.1 HDMI cable to get 4k and multiple brands offer that. Also length of cable does matter, as with Ethernet the longer the cable the more quality you lose.

If a 3' cable is all you need then buy that over the 6' one. A great source for cables is monoprice.com

Also one other small tip, take into account how close to the TV you're actually going to be. A huge TV you're too close to will look worse than a smaller TV you're a tad far from.

1 to 1.5 times the size of the TV is how far your optimal viewing spot is.

So for a 40" TV you'd want to be at least 40" away up to 60" away. So if you're 5' from the screen a 75" will look awful.
